当前位置:首页 > 虚拟机 > 正文

虚拟机服务器的硬件配置(虚拟机20开的电脑配置)


一、开10个虚拟机,电脑至少需要什么配置?

同时运行十个虚拟机肯定需要更高配置的计算机。但具体到什么程度,取决于这十台虚拟机主要虚拟哪个操作系统,以及虚拟操作系统主要用来做什么。

1.必要条件。CPU肯定要支持VT技术(即虚拟化技术,可以考虑使用IntelCorei74790K或者性能相当的CPU)。

2内存如果所有虚拟机都运行XP等操作系统,则必须至少分配1G内存,XP才能顺利运行。除了主机本身需要的内存外,至少16G内存就可以满足需要。如果您使用虚拟WINDOWS7,则内存必须约为。64GB。

扩展信息:

虚拟机的规范对对象的内部结构没有特殊要求。在Sun的实现中,对对象的引用是一个包含一对指针的句柄:一个指针指向对象的方法表,另一个指向对象的数据。以Java虚拟机字节码表示的程序应遵循类型约定。

Java虚拟机实现应该拒绝运行违反类型规范的字节码程序。由于字节码定义的限制,Java虚拟机似乎只能在具有32位地址空间的机器上运行。但可以创建一个自动将字节码转换为64位形式的Java虚拟机。

从Java虚拟机支持的数据类型可以看出,Java对于数据类型的内部格式有严格的规定,使得不同Java虚拟机的实现对数据的解释是相同的方式,从而保证提高Java的平台独立性和可移植性。

参考来源:百度百-虚拟机


二、将运行多个虚拟机的计算机硬件要求

运行多个虚拟机的计算机硬件要求:同时运行多个虚拟机,所需配置为:双核或以上CPU、4G内存、256G硬盘、集成显卡。配置越高,运行的虚拟机就越多。有很多,而且运行起来非常流畅。

运行多个虚拟机的具体硬件要求:

1.最低硬件配置:CPU赛扬1.7GHz、内存1GB、可用磁盘空间6GB、64MB显存独立显卡。

2.推荐硬件配置:CPUPentium42.4GHz、内存2GB、可用磁盘空间10GB、128MB显存独立显卡。

3.解释:虚拟机(VirtualMachine)是指通过软件模拟的、在完全隔离的环境中运行的具有完整硬件系统功能的完整计算机系统。

4.关于电脑配置,还是要看你运行什么系统,有多少个系统。一般来说,如果一台VMWARE同时运行2003和XP进行实验,内存最好有1G。并且CPU频率在3G以上,或者双核。否则系统会非常慢。

5.低于P42G。512内存,运行起来会很吃力。当你进行实验时,事情常常会出错。

虚拟机介绍:

6.虚拟机是通过软件模拟完整的硬件系统功能并在完全隔离的环境中运行的完整计算机系统。

7.虚拟系统与真实的windows系统具有完全相同的功能。进入虚拟系统后,所有操作都在这个新的独立虚拟系统中进行,软件可以独立安装和运行。节省数据,拥有自己的独立桌面。

8.它不会对真实系统产生任何影响,并且具有一类可以在现有系统和虚拟镜像之间灵活切换的操作系统。虚拟系统不会降低计算机的性能。虚拟系统启动比真实系统更快,运行程序也更方便、快捷。

扩展信息:

虚拟机所需硬件:

1。CPU:虚拟机的每个vCPU仅运行在一个物理核心之上,CPU频率越高,虚拟机运行的速度就越快。更多的vCPU将有助于提高应用程序性能。一个复杂的因素是,在ESXi服务器中,所有虚拟机共享相同的物理CPU。

2.如果虚拟机需要占用大量CPU时间,可以考虑为虚拟机分配第二个vCPU。然而,为虚拟机分配两个以上的vCPU并不一定能让应用程序运行得更快,因为只有多线程应用程序才能有效地使用多个vCPU。

:ESXi服务器中的RAM资源通常是有限的,因此在为虚拟机分配RAM时需要格外小心。VMkernel在处理RAM方面非常聪明;它允许虚拟机使用ESXi服务器的所有物理内存,并尽量避免占用物理内存而不实际使用它。

4.当物理内存完全用完后,VMkernel必须确定哪些虚拟机可以保留物理内存以及哪些虚拟机需要释放物理内存。这称为“内存回收”。当虚拟机占用的物理内存被回收时,存在影响虚拟机性能的风险。虚拟机回收的内存越多,相应的风险就越大。

虚拟机的作用:

5.虚拟机在现实中的作用还是相当大的。例如,最简单的计算机没有CD-ROM驱动器。如果要安装系统,可以使用虚拟机。安装系统时,虚拟机内部有一个虚拟光驱,支持直接打开系统镜像文件来安装系统。

6.另外,虚拟机技术在游戏爱好者眼中也非常实用。例如,计算机上的许多游戏一般不支持同时运行多个游戏,但您可以在计算机上多创建几个虚拟机。然后,该程序可以在虚拟机系统中单独运行,从而可以在一台计算机上同时打开同一个游戏。

参考资料:-虚拟机